About the Office Space & Property Management Division:
Office Space & Property Management (OSPM) oversees the operation of the Agency's economic development and waterfront portfolio, which includes the management of 21 buildings, consisting of over 4 million square feet of space across multiple facilities, as well as the management and day-to-day operations of approximately 1.4 million square feet of Agency office space, occupied by approximately 2,500 Port Authority employees. OSPM is responsible for the coordination and facilitation of all required structural, vertical transportation and fire/life safety inspections. OSPM conceptualizes and advances development opportunities, including enhanced revenue initiatives, as well as disposition of non-core assets, community revitalization, job generation, and increased use of public transportation. OSPM provides for the management of office renovations, relocations, construction, interior design (furniture) and Port Authority standards for all Port Authority facilities and leased properties. OSPM's goal is to manage these facilities in a safe, efficient, cost-effective manner that encourages staff productivity. OSPM seeks to implement sustainability initiatives that reduce energy consumption and costs.
